April 20 Day 43: Whiteboarding it

Today I had a positive interaction with my precalculus students and the shared whiteboard in Zoom. We were using transformations to graph basic functions. Starting with a simple power function, they individually contributed by computing points, plotting them on the axes provided, and connecting the dots. The same process was repeated with a related but transformed function. Hearts for the points of the former, stars for the points of the latter. It may look a little messy but it sounded to me like there was joy and wonder interacting in a new way online.
